What is Omnichannel Marketing?
Omnichannel marketing is an approach that provides customers with a seamless experience across various channels, both online and offline. This strategy recognizes that consumers interact with brands through multiple touchpoints, including social media, email, websites, mobile apps, and physical stores. An effective omnichannel strategy ensures that these touchpoints are interconnected and provide a consistent message, creating a cohesive brand experience.
The Importance of a Seamless Customer Experience
In an era where consumers expect personalized and convenient experiences, omnichannel marketing is essential. Customers want to engage with brands in a way that is fluid and straightforward. For example, a customer might discover a product on social media, research it on a website, and complete the purchase in a physical store. Omnichannel marketing ensures that the transitions between these channels are smooth, enhancing customer satisfaction and loyalty.

Integrating Data Analytics with Omnichannel Marketing
The integration of data analytics and omnichannel marketing creates a formidable strategy that amplifies the effectiveness of marketing efforts. Here’s how businesses can leverage both elements to craft winning strategies:
Personalization at Scale
Data analytics enables marketers to gather insights about customer preferences and behaviors. By applying these insights across various channels, brands can deliver personalized content and offers tailored to individual customers. This level of personalization not only enhances the customer experience but also increases the likelihood of conversion.
Real-Time Decision Making
With access to real-time data, marketers can adjust their campaigns on the fly. This agility allows businesses to respond to emerging trends, customer feedback, and changes in market dynamics promptly. By continuously analyzing performance metrics across channels, marketers can identify what works best and optimize their strategies in real-time.
Measuring Campaign Effectiveness
The combination of data analytics and omnichannel marketing also facilitates the measurement of campaign effectiveness. Marketers can track how consumers interact with different channels and assess which touchpoints are driving conversions. This data not only highlights successful strategies but also uncovers areas for improvement, enabling ongoing refinement of marketing efforts.
